Meta Descriptions provide concise explanations of the contents of web pages, that are commonly used by search engines on search result pages to display preview snippets for a given page.

Tips:
1. it is best to keep meta descriptions between 70-160 characters.
2. a readable, compelling description using important keywords can draw a much higher click-through rate of searchers to the given web page.
3. avoid keyword stuffing, ensure each page has its own unique description.

Underscore In URL
Excellent! your do not use underscore in your URLs.

Search Engines treat hyphen as word separator, they do not treat underscore as word separator.


Tips:
1. use hyphen "-" instead of underscore "_" to optimize your page url.
2. help search engines to better understand your url, eventually will benefit your page`s ranking.

Server Signature
Excellent! the website server signature is off.

A secure and safe server is not only good for your site visitors but also good for search engines.

Tips:
1. server software version information can be utilized by malicious visitors to attack your server.
2. by turning off the server signature, you actually have made your server a little bit more secure.
3. for Apache server - edit the apache2.conf or the .htaccess file to turn server signature off.
